Hi all!!

I'm Mark and for the last 3 years I've been building my car with the help of this site so I thought there were some thanks and some lessons I've learned through the first phase of the build to pass on and to enjoy everything this site can offer!

The car in question is a series 2 gti which as far as I can tell hasn't seen the road in about 10 years between me and previous owners. I found the car out in the countryside just outside Canterbury in a shed that fro. The looks of it was just about supporting its own weight. The son had bought the car to build into a race car… Needless to say the 13 window Camper and the AC Cobra were a bit too much of a distraction and it ended up home with me after the princely sum of £500!! But then again it only came with 2 front seats and a dash so it needed some help.

This is as she sits now hopefully ready for the mot in a couple of weeks…
